What Makes an Online Casino Trustworthy?

A reputable casino should clearly display its licensing information, company details, privacy policy, and terms and conditions. Regulatory oversight does not guarantee that every game will produce a win, but it provides an important framework for player protection, responsible operation, and dispute handling. Look for licensing details in the website footer and verify that the operator’s registered name matches the information shown by the relevant authority.

Security is equally important. Established operators normally use encrypted connections to protect account credentials and payment information. They may also provide two-factor authentication, identity verification, and automated systems designed to detect unusual activity. These features can seem like minor inconveniences, but they help reduce fraud and safeguard both the player and the casino.

Essential Safety Checks Before Registration

  • Confirm that the casino holds a recognized gambling licence.
  • Read the privacy policy and understand how personal data is handled.
  • Check whether games come from established software providers.
  • Review withdrawal limits, processing times, and verification requirements.
  • Make sure customer support is available through practical channels.

Comparing Bonuses and Casino Promotions

Welcome bonuses can add value to a new account, but the headline amount is only one part of the offer. A promotion may include a deposit match, free spins, cashback, reload rewards, or loyalty points. Each incentive has its own wagering conditions, eligible games, minimum deposit, maximum conversion amount, and expiry date.

Promotion Feature What to Check
Deposit match Percentage offered, maximum bonus, and qualifying deposit
Wagering requirement How many times the bonus and deposit must be played through
Free spins Eligible slot, value per spin, and any winnings cap
Cashback Calculation method, qualifying losses, and payment schedule
Expiry period Time available to claim, use, or complete the promotion

For example, a large bonus with a high wagering requirement may be less attractive than a smaller reward with clear and flexible conditions. Players should also check whether game contributions differ. Slots often contribute fully, while roulette, blackjack, baccarat, and live games may contribute at reduced percentages or may be excluded completely.

Game Selection, Software, and Fairness

A competitive casino should offer a balanced library rather than relying on a handful of popular titles. Slots may include classic fruit machines, video slots, cluster-pay games, branded releases, and jackpot products. Table game fans may prefer multiple versions of blackjack, roulette, baccarat, and poker. Live casino rooms add a social element through real dealers and streamed tables.

Game quality is supported by independent testing and random number generation. Licensed casinos generally work with testing agencies that assess whether games operate according to approved mathematical models. This does not remove normal gambling risk: random outcomes mean that previous results do not predict future spins, cards, or rolls. A fair game can still produce short-term losses, so players should treat entertainment value as the main purpose.

Choosing Games Responsibly

Before playing, understand the volatility and return-to-player information where it is available. Higher-volatility games may deliver larger prizes less frequently, while lower-volatility games may provide smaller wins more often. Neither option guarantees profit. Set a budget first, select stakes that feel comfortable, and avoid increasing wagers to recover losses.

Payments, Withdrawals, and Customer Support

Payment options should match the player’s location and preferences. Common methods include debit cards, bank transfers, electronic wallets, prepaid solutions, and selected digital currencies. Deposits are often processed quickly, while withdrawals may take longer because casinos must complete identity and anti-fraud checks.

Always review the minimum and maximum transaction amounts, possible fees, supported currencies, and expected processing times. A trustworthy operator explains verification requirements before a withdrawal is requested. If support is needed, live chat is usually the fastest option, while email can be useful for detailed account matters. Test customer service with a basic question before making a deposit and assess whether the response is clear and professional.

Responsible Gambling Should Come First

Responsible gambling tools help players maintain control. Useful features may include deposit limits, loss limits, session reminders, cooling-off periods, reality checks, and self-exclusion. These controls are most effective when activated before problems develop rather than after a budget has already been exceeded.

Never borrow money to gamble, chase losses, or use gambling as a solution to financial stress. If gaming stops feeling entertaining, take a break and seek support from a recognized gambling-help organization in your region. The best online casino experience is based on informed choices, realistic expectations, and spending only what you can comfortably afford to lose.
